kNotes on the Print Set [Date] Option

 

The date and time printed on pictures with DPOF

 

printing when [Date] in the print set menu is enabled

 

are those recorded with the picture when it was

 

taken. Date and time printed using this option are not

 

affected when the camera’s date and time setting are

 

changed from the setup menu after pictures are

 

recorded.

lDifferences Between Print Set and Date Imprint

Date and time can only be printed on pictures using the [Date] option in the print set menu when pictures are printed from a DPOF-compatible printer (c 120). Use the [Date imprint] (c 94) option in the setup menu to print the date on pictures from a printer that does not support DPOF (position of the date is fixed at the bottom right hand corner of the picture). Once the [Date imprint] option is enabled, the date forms a permanent part of the image and cannot be deleted from pictures.

When the date option for both [Print set] and [Date imprint] is enabled, only the date from the [Date imprint] option is printed, even when a DPOF-compatible printer is used.
